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Inspection

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age to your home. Our team is here to help you identify the warning signs and take action before it’s too late.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ice a musty smell in your home,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action quickly.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Warped or discolored fl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s crucial to inspect the area and address the issue quickly.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Water stains can show a leak or water damage. If you notice any water stains,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action quickly to prevent further dam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your paint or wallpaper, it’s crucial to inspect the area and address the issue quickly.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ks can show a water damage issue. If you notice any unusual sounds or leaks,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action quickly to prevent further damage.

How can I prevent water damage in the future?

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ent water damage. Check your roof, gutters, and downspouts regularly to ensure they’re functioning properly. Also, keep an eye out for signs of water damage, such as warping or discoloration.
